Looking for warm weather? Then head to Northport in July, when the average temperature is 80.6 °F, and the highest can go up to 91.4 °F. The coldest month, on the other hand, is January, when it can get as cold as 33.8 °F, with an average temperature of 44.6 °F. You’re likely to see more rain in March, when precipitation is around 5.9″. In contrast, October is usually the driest month of the year in Northport, with an average rainfall of 3.1″.

How to Get to Northport

Plane

Although Northport doesn’t have its own airport, you can fly to Birmingham (BHM), which is located 85 km from Northport. Montgomery Dannelly Field is the most popular, with regular flights from American Airlines, Delta, WestJet and other airlines departing from the United States. The shortest domestic flight to Northport departs from Tampa and takes around 1h 30m.

Car

Another option to get to Northport is to pick up a car rental from Atlanta, which is about 301 km from Northport. You’ll find branches of Routes Car & Truck Rentals and Ace, among others, in Atlanta.

Renting a car in Northport

Renting a car in Northport costs $57 per day, on average, or $228 if you want to rent if for 4 days.

It’s generally cheaper to rent your vehicle outside the airport: locations in the city are around 6% cheaper than airport locations in Northport.

Expect to pay $4.43 per gallon in Northport (average price from the past 30 days). Depending on the size of your rental car, filling up the tank will cost between $53.15 and $70.86.
